Add 98/40 and 40/25
1st number: 2 18/40, 2nd number: 1 15/25
98/40 + 40/25 is 81/20.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 40 and 25 is 200
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 200 - For the 1st fraction, since 40 × 5 = 200,
98/40 = 98 × 5/40 × 5 = 490/200 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 25 × 8 = 200,
40/25 = 40 × 8/25 × 8 = 320/200 - Add the two like fractions:
490/200 + 320/200 = 490 + 320/200 = 810/200 - 810/200 simplified gives 81/20
- So, 98/40 + 40/25 = 81/20
